Agriculture:

In the agriculture industry, drones play a significant role in optimizing farming practices and improving crop yield. With the use of drones equipped with various sensors, farmers can gather essential data such as crop health, soil moisture levels, and pest infestations. This data enables farmers to make informed decisions regarding irrigation, fertilization, and pesticide application, ultimately leading to better crop production.

Furthermore, drones can be used for precision agriculture, allowing farmers to monitor their fields with high accuracy and efficiency. By using drones for aerial imaging and mapping, farmers can create detailed field maps, identify crop stress areas, and assess overall crop health. This information can help farmers detect problems early on, leading to timely interventions and increased crop yield.

In addition to monitoring crops, drones can also be used for spraying fertilizers and pesticides, reducing the need for manual labor and minimizing chemical exposure to workers. With the ability to cover large areas in a short amount of time, drones offer a cost-effective and efficient solution for crop spraying, resulting in better crop protection and higher yields.

Overall, drones have revolutionized the agriculture industry by providing farmers with valuable data and efficient solutions to optimize their farming practices. With the use of drones, farmers can increase productivity, reduce costs, and improve overall crop yield.

Construction:

The construction industry has embraced drones as a valuable tool for project management, surveying, and monitoring. Drones equipped with high-resolution cameras and sensors can capture detailed images and data of construction sites, providing project managers with accurate information for planning and decision-making.

One of the main advantages of using drones in construction is their ability to conduct aerial surveys and mapping in a cost-effective and efficient manner. By flying drones over construction sites, project managers can create 3D models, topographic maps, and volumetric measurements, helping them track progress, identify potential issues, and make informed decisions.

In addition to surveying, drones can also be used for monitoring construction progress, inspecting structures, and ensuring the safety of workers. By using drones for aerial inspections, construction companies can identify potential safety hazards, structural defects, and quality issues, enabling them to take corrective actions in a timely manner.

Furthermore, drones can improve communication and collaboration among project stakeholders by providing real-time data and visualizations of construction sites. By sharing drone footage and data with architects, engineers, and clients, construction companies can ensure that everyone is on the same page and work together effectively to complete projects successfully.

Overall, drones have revolutionized the construction industry by providing a safe, efficient, and cost-effective solution for project management, surveying, and monitoring. With the use of drones, construction companies can improve productivity, reduce risks, and deliver high-quality projects on time and within budget.

Mining:

In the mining industry, drones have become an essential tool for exploring, mapping, and monitoring various mining operations. With the ability to access remote and hazardous areas, drones offer mining companies a safe and efficient solution for collecting data, inspecting equipment, and monitoring production processes.

One of the main applications of drones in mining is aerial surveying and mapping, which allows mining companies to create detailed 3D models, topographic maps, and volumetric measurements of mining sites. By using drones for aerial imaging, mining companies can accurately assess the quantity and quality of mineral reserves, optimize mine planning, and make informed decisions regarding resource extraction.

Additionally, drones can be used for monitoring stockpile inventory, tracking equipment utilization, and ensuring compliance with safety regulations. By using drones for aerial inspections, mining companies can identify operational inefficiencies, equipment failures, and safety hazards, enabling them to implement preventive maintenance and improve overall operational efficiency.

Furthermore, drones can enhance environmental monitoring and compliance by providing real-time data and visualizations of mining sites and their impact on surrounding ecosystems. By using drones for environmental monitoring, mining companies can assess the environmental footprint of their operations, identify potential risks, and implement sustainable practices to minimize environmental impact.

Overall, drones have revolutionized the mining industry by providing mining companies with valuable data, efficient solutions, and improved safety measures for exploring, mapping, and monitoring mining operations. With the use of drones, mining companies can increase productivity, reduce costs, and ensure environmental sustainability in their operations.

Oil & Gas:

The oil and gas industry has embraced drones as a valuable tool for exploring, inspecting, and monitoring various oil and gas facilities. With the ability to access remote and hazardous areas, drones offer oil and gas companies a safe and efficient solution for collecting data, conducting inspections, and ensuring regulatory compliance.

One of the main applications of drones in the oil and gas industry is aerial inspection of pipelines, offshore platforms, and other infrastructure. By using drones equipped with high-resolution cameras and sensors, oil and gas companies can conduct visual inspections, detect leaks, and identify structural defects in a cost-effective and efficient manner.

Additionally, drones can be used for monitoring oil and gas facilities, assessing environmental impact, and ensuring compliance with safety regulations. By using drones for aerial surveillance, oil and gas companies can monitor production processes, detect potential hazards, and implement preventive measures to ensure the safety of workers and the environment.

Furthermore, drones can enhance emergency response and disaster management by providing real-time data and visualizations of oil and gas facilities during emergencies or natural disasters. By using drones for emergency response, oil and gas companies can assess damage, coordinate rescue efforts, and mitigate risks, ultimately minimizing downtime and reducing costly disruptions to operations.

Overall, drones have revolutionized the oil and gas industry by providing oil and gas companies with valuable data, cost-effective solutions, and improved safety measures for exploring, inspecting, and monitoring oil and gas facilities. With the use of drones, oil and gas companies can increase operational efficiency, reduce risks, and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ements.

Transportation & Logistics:

The transportation and logistics industry has embraced drones as a valuable tool for delivering goods, conducting inventory checks, and optimizing supply chain operations. With the ability to access remote areas and deliver packages quickly, drones offer transportation and logistics companies a cost-effective and efficient solution for last-mile delivery and inventory management.

One of the main applications of drones in the transportation and logistics industry is last-mile delivery, which allows companies to deliver packages directly to customers' doorsteps in a timely manner. By using drones for delivery, transportation and logistics companies can reduce delivery times, lower costs, and improve customer satisfaction, especially in remote or hard-to-reach areas.

Additionally, drones can be used for conducting inventory checks, monitoring warehouse operations, and optimizing supply chain logistics. By using drones for inventory management, transportation and logistics companies can automate stocktaking, reduce human error, and ensure accurate inventory levels, ultimately leading to improved operational efficiency and cost savings.

Furthermore, drones can enhance safety and security in transportation and logistics operations by providing real-time monitoring, surveillance, and tracking of goods and vehicles. By using drones for security purposes, transportation and logistics companies can deter theft, prevent accidents, and ensure compliance with safety regulations, ultimately protecting assets and maintaining customer trust.

Overall, drones have revolutionized the transportation and logistics industry by providing companies with efficient solutions, cost savings, and improved customer service for delivering goods, conducting inventory checks, and optimizing supply chain operations. With the use of drones, transportation and logistics companies can increase operational ef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ance safety and security in their operations.
